Body found in burning vehicle near Marengo, sheriff’s office says

emergency lights

One person is dead after a vehicle was found engulfed in flames southwest of Marengo, the McHenry County Sheriff’s Office said.

Deputies responded about 1:50 a.m. Friday to a call for a motorist assist near the intersection of Blissdale and Jackson roads, Deputy Kevin Byrnes said in an email. The deputies then called the Marengo Fire Protection District.

The fire district responded, but the fire was “basically out” when crews arrived, fire Chief John Kimmel said. The fire had burned to a point where there was nothing left on the car to burn, he said.

Once the fire was extinguished, a body was found inside the vehicle, Byrnes said.

When asked whether the incident was considered suspicious, Byrnes said it still is an active investigation, and more information will be released at a later date.

No deputies were injured in the incident, he said. Neither were any fire personnel, Kimmel said.

McHenry County Coroner Michael Rein declined to comment.
